Output 51fea866b19c1ef1538bba14c81fadbc2302f2099528f0011a600a92ce1fc359:1

value
2586576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8c49774eb25e60ca187e7f6c79706e2ca44096e OP_EQUALVERIFY OP_CHECKSIG
address
1LmATrwrmiEuUD9efqNKX5hKLvajwRQCpG
transaction
51fea866b19c1ef1538bba14c81fadbc2302f2099528f0011a600a92ce1fc359